Multiple defendants are often involved in mesothelioma lawsuits. Typically, victims are able to bring a lawsuit against a variety of companies that exposed them to asbestos. These lawsuits also seek to recover comp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and other financial losses due to mesothelioma.
If asbestos exposure was a result of work asbestos victims should think about filing a workers compensation claim.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ist their clients through the procedure of filing workers’ compensation claims, as well as other documents required to conclude a successful case.
Wrongful death lawsuits are another mesothelioma type that could result in significant financial damages to the loved ones of the victim. These lawsuits are filed by the survivors of spouses, children or other relatives of deceased asbestos compensation victims.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ers will not charge any upfront fees or force you to pay for their services unless they prevail in your case. This arrangement, also known as a contingent fee, helps victims get the best legal representation. A contingency fee is a portion of the total compensation that is given to you or your loved one, and it means that you won’t be held accountable for any out-of-pocket fees.
